Why are some plurals irregular?

An irregular plural noun refers simply to nouns that do not form their plural by adding -s or -es. A very common example is the word man: you don’t form the plural by making it mans; instead, the plural form is men.

What are irregular nouns examples?

Irregular Nouns That Change Completely Some irregular nouns don’t follow any established rules to become plural. For example, the plural of person is people, the plural of woman is women, and the plural of goose is geese. Similarly, mouse becomes mice in its plural form, while house becomes houses.

What does irregular plural mean?

Irregular plural nouns are nouns that do not become plural by adding -s or -es, as most nouns in the English language do. … For example, the plural form of man is men, not mans. The plural form of woman is women, not womans. Can you say criterias?
